Job Details:
Position: Fellow Nuclear Safety Engineer
Location: Central, South Carolina (Hybrid)
Duration: 12+ Months contract with possible extension
DUTIES
Apply technical experience in field of specialization or broad-based experience in multiple technical fields, and use other technical resources within the company, to resolve complex problems.
Incorporate advanced technical practices and a variety of complex features such as complicated technical requirements, application of new or special materials or processes and difficult coordination or oversight requirements into problem solving and program planning.
Provide leadership in determining solutions to complex problems and be recognized as having expertise in a functional area(s) of technical expertise.
Develop solutions to complex technical problems in fields of expertise.
Keep informed on technical needs within the company and technical trends in area of expertise in the external world.
Be aware of capabilities of the work group and needs of its customers. Identify technical programs which can be carried out with little guidance and take the initiative to accomplish them.
Lead task teams for developing solutions to more complex problems. Prepare plans including schedules, budgets and personnel requirements for solving major technical tasks identified by management.
Develop schedules, monitor progress, monitor expenditures of budget and review quality of work performed. Include research, development, testing, quality assurance requirements.
Communicate the results and objectives verbally and in manuscript form to customers, colleagues, managers and oversight groups.
Prepare reports for external publication.
Education:
An advanced degree and experience, a Ph.D. degree and about 10 years' experience.
OR A MS degree and 12 years' experience.
OR A BS degree and approximately 15 years' experience.
Experience/Skills:
Considered an internal expert in area of expertise. Contributes to advancing knowledge in field of expertise through various avenues such as internal and external publications and professional society presentations. Can solve complex problems in field.
Experience working in the nuclear safety industry through support of the Department of Energy (DOE) or the commercial nuclear industry.
Previous Experience with the use and implementation of 10 CFR 830, DOE O 413.3, DOE O 421.1, and related directives and standards is required.
P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S
Candidates who have possessed an active DOE clearance (L or Q) within the past two (2) years are preferred.
Previous experience in developing, reviewing, and maintaining DOE safety basis documents is preferred.
Previous DOE experience is preferred.
